Best e90 front bumper?
Had a fender bender and looking to replace my e90 335 sedan bumper.
Where and what bumper should i get? My current bumper has no pdc and has headlight washers. None of the bumpers i see have this. Can the m3 replica work? Looking for something better looking than my oem. Please let me know which site is best to purchase from too. Thanks!

M-tech bumper is what most get. There are a few versions (some more true than others), but you can even get them on eBay. You just have to look for the ones that have the headlight washers. PDC I think will be the harder one -- IIRC stock bumpers already have the cutout shape on the inside of the bumper (if you had to drill), not sure about aftermarket.
